Towards Bayesian Photometric Cosmic Chronometers: Application to VIPERS
Bayesian photometric cosmic chronometer analysis on VIPERS PDR2 data yields H(z=0.65)=93.68±28.27(stat)±10.67(syst) km/s/Mpc, consistent with spectroscopic CC results and Planck ΛCDM, as a proof of concept for photometric surveys.

Deep Extragalactic VIsible Legacy Survey (DEVILS): Morphologically-selected galaxy merger fractions and their direct comparison to close-pair samples
Morphological merger fractions exceed close-pair fractions across 0.2<z<0.9 in DEVILS, with minimal sample overlap, attributed to different merger stages and timescales.
